這篇文章給大家聊聊關于javaindexof返回值,以及indexof什么意思對應的知識點,希望對各位有所幫助,不要忘了收藏本站哦。
indexmatch返回結果有重復值如何去掉
可以使用數組公式或者輔助列來去掉重復值。首先,你可以使用數組公式,在公式計算的結果中,對重復值進行去重,具體方法是在公式最外層套上“UNIQUE”函數,這樣就可以保留不重復的結果。其次,你也可以利用輔助列來去掉重復值,先在另外一列里面用“COUNTIF”函數來計算重復值的數量,然后在原始數據中使用“IF”函數,如果計數器的值小于等于1,則返回原始數據的值,否則返回空字符串,這樣就可以達到去重的目的。即使使用了這些方法,也需要注意索引和匹配的列是否選擇正確,避免因為查找列選擇錯誤而導致返回結果存在重復值。
String的方法indexOf(String str) 返回第一次出現的指定子字符串在此字符串中的索引
str="abc",inti=str.indexof("b")其中i=1;//索引以0開始str="youarevergood",inti=str.indexof("are")中i=4;intj=str.indexof("good")中j=12s=str.subString(i,j)中s=arever//s末尾有一個空格
index和match函數如何返回多個值
在Excel中,INDEX和MATCH函數本身無法直接返回多個值。它們的主要功能是在給定一個范圍內搜索特定條件并返回單個值。但是可以通過結合其他函數或使用數組公式來實現返回多個值的效果。
一種方法是使用INDEX和SMALL函數來返回多個匹配項。假設你要在一個數據區域中查找符合特定條件的多個值,你可以使用MATCH函數找到匹配的位置,然后使用SMALL函數和INDEX函數根據匹配位置返回對應的多個值。
以下是一個示例公式:
1.在一個單元格范圍內,輸入以下數組公式(使用Ctrl+Shift+Enter):
```excel=INDEX(數據范圍,SMALL(IF(條件范圍=條件,ROW(條件范圍)-ROW(第一個條件單元格)+1),ROW(A1)))```
可以將"數據范圍"替換為你要返回值的數據范圍,"條件范圍"替換為條件的范圍,"條件"替換為你要匹配的條件,"第一個條件單元格"替換為條件范圍的第一個單元格。
2.將上述公式拖動或復制到其他單元格中,它將返回滿足條件的多個值。
需要注意的是,這是一個數組公式,必須使用Ctrl+Shift+Enter鍵進行輸入。
另外,如果你使用的是較新的Excel版本(如Office365),可以考慮使用FILTER函數來實現返回多個值。FILTER函數可以根據指定的條件從一個數據范圍中篩選出多個匹配值。使用類似以下的公式:```
excel=FILTER(數據范圍,條件范圍=條件)```
這將返回滿足條件的多個值。
請注意,FILTER函數僅適用于較新的Excel版本,舊版本可能不支持該函數。
excel中index函數的引用區域單元格的作用
INDEX用于返回表格或區域中的數值或對數值的引用。函數INDEX()有兩種形式:數組和引用。數組形式通常返回數值或數值數組;引用形式通常返回引用。
(1)INDEX(array,row_num,column_num)返回數組中指定單元格或單元格數組的數值。
Array為單元格區域或數組常數。
Row_num為數組中某行的行序號,函數從該行返回數值。
Column_num為數組中某列的列序號,函數從該列返回數值。
需注意的是Row_num和column_num必須指向array中的某一單元格,否則,函數INDEX返回錯誤值#REF!。
(2)INDEX(reference,row_num,column_num,area_num)返回引用中指定單元格或單元格區域的引用。
Reference為對一個或多個單元格區域的引用。
Row_num為引用中某行的行序號,函數從該行返回一個引用。
Column_num為引用中某列的列序號,函數從該列返回一個引用。需注意的是Row_num、column_num和area_num必須指向reference中的單元格;否則,函數INDEX返回錯誤值#REF!。
如果省略row_num和column_num,函數INDEX返回由area_num所指定的區域。
index函數的語法格式及其具體含義
返回數據表區域的值或對值的引用。
Index函數的兩種形式:數組和引用。
數組形式——返回數組中指定單元格或單元格數組的數值。
引用形式——返回引用中指定單元格或單元格區域的引用。
2.index函數的語法格式
數組形式=index(array,row_num,column_num)
=index(數據表區域,行數,列數)
引用形式=index(reference,row_num,column_num,area_num)
=index(一個或多個單元格區域的引用,行數,列數,從第幾個選擇區域內引用)
1.MATCH函數含義:返回指定數值在指定數組區域中的位置
2.語法:MATCH(lookup_value,lookup_array,match_type)
lookup_value:需要在數據表(lookup_array)中查找的值。
lookup_array:可能包含有所要查找數值的連續的單元格區域,區域必須包含在某一行或某一列,即必須為一維數據,引用的查找區域是一維數組。
match_type:為1時,查找小于或等于lookup_value的最大數值在lookup_array中的位置,lookup_array必須按升序排列:
為0時,查找等于lookup_value的第一個數值,lookup_array按任意順序排列:
為-1時,查找大于或等于lookup_value的最小數值在lookup_array中的位置,lookup_array必須按降序排列。利用MATCH函數查找功能時,當查找條件存在時,MATCH函數結果為具體位置(數值),否則顯示#N/A錯誤。
javaindexof返回值和indexof什么意思的問題分享結束啦,以上的文章解決了您的問題嗎?歡迎您下次再來哦!